This is so satisfying and filling and delicious! Don't let the blurry photo fool ya! It's out of Gabriel Cousen's book, 'Rainbow Green Live Food Cuisine'. (not the photo, the recipe, lol) Anyway, it says to use a dehydrator, and I'm sure that just sends it over the top into tastyland, but I don't have one yet, and I just went for it without one, and still, I'm head over heels in love with this dish! If you have a food processor, you're good to go! But here is the recipe as it appears in the book, with my add-ons in brackets.

Chop up:
2 carrots
2 celery
1 red pepper
1/4 to 1/2 cup leek (I did green onion)
Add about 1/4 cup olive oil and a touch of Celtic salt (I did sesame oil, and Himalayan rock salt)
stir it up and put it in your dehydrator for an hour. (I did not!)

During that time in the food processor add:
1/2 cup soaked sun dried tomatoes
4 tomatoes
2 avocados
1 T ginger (I had none and don't know what I missed!)
A little more Celtic/Rock salt
2 T Chili powder
2 t ground cumin
pinch o' cayenne (HOT!)
Mix this with the veggies above and put it back in the dehydrator for one more hour. (Or just mix it together and serve it up, as I did!)
